To calculate work done, use the formula: Work Done = Force x Distance x cos(θ). Force is measured in Newtons (N), Distance in meters (m), and θ is the angle between the force and the direction of motion. For example, if you push a box with a force of 10 N for 5 meters, and the force is applied in the direction of motion (θ=0), the work done is: 10 N x 5 m = 50 Joules.

- What are the units used to measure work done? Work done is measured in Joules (J), where 1 Joule is equal to 1 Newton meter (N·m).

- Can work be negative? Yes, work can be negative if the force acts in the opposite direction to the motion. This occurs when the angle θ is greater than 90 degrees.
